Best for beginners: Zapier

Best for:
Zapier is the ideal choice for beginners in business automation, enabling users to connect over 7,000 apps effortlessly. It excels in automating repetitive tasks, making it perfect for those looking to enhance productivity without a steep learning curve.
Key Features
- 7000 Integrations: Connects with a vast array of applications to streamline workflows.
- AI-Powered Workflow Upgrades: Enhances automation capabilities with intelligent suggestions.
- Visual Editor: Allows users to create workflows easily without coding knowledge.
- Task Automation Solutions: Automates routine tasks to save time and reduce errors.
🏷️ Pricing Information Zapier offers a free plan that allows for 100 tasks per month. Paid plans start at $19.99 per month, providing additional features and higher task limits. However, costs can increase as your automation needs grow.
Pros ✅:
- Huge app ecosystem for diverse integrations.
- Intuitive user interface for easy navigation.
- Powerful AI-enhanced automation capabilities.
Cons ❌:
- Costs can escalate as you scale your usage.
- The free plan may feel limited for larger tasks.
- Some advanced features may require a learning curve.
In summary, Zapier stands out as one of the best automation tools for small businesses, making it a valuable asset for anyone looking to optimize their workflow management.

Best for Makers with Visual Workflow Builders: Make

Best for: Make is ideal for creative makers who appreciate a visual, drag-and-drop interface for their automation needs. This platform empowers users to design intricate workflows with ease, making it accessible for those who may not have a technical background.
Key Features
- Visual drag-and-drop builder: Simplifies the creation of workflows without coding knowledge.
- Routers & filters: Allows for precise control over data flow and task execution.
- Scheduled scenarios: Automate tasks at specific times to enhance productivity.
- API access: Integrate with various applications for seamless connectivity.
- Collaboration tools: Work with teams effectively on shared projects.
🏷️ Pricing Information Make offers a free plan that allows up to 1,000 operations per month, making it accessible for small businesses. Paid plans start at $9 per month, providing additional features and higher operation limits.
Pros and Cons
✅ Pros:
- Affordable pricing for small businesses.
- Feature-rich platform with extensive capabilities.
- Intuitive interface that simplifies workflow creation.
❌ Cons:
- Minimum 15-minute interval may restrict real-time task automation.
- More complex than some alternatives like Zapier, which may deter beginners.
- Learning curve for advanced features could be steep for some users.
In conclusion, Make stands out as one of the best automation tools for small businesses, offering powerful task automation solutions and workflow management capabilities.
Best for Hands-on Teams Seeking Self-Hosted Solutions: n8n

n8n is an excellent choice for hands-on teams that favor low-code, self-hosted solutions. Its DIY approach allows technical teams to maintain deep control over their integrations, making it ideal for those who want to customize their workflow automation tools extensively.
Key Features
- Open-source tool flexibility: Users can modify the software to fit their specific needs.
- AI agents builder: Create intelligent automation processes that enhance productivity.
- Shared projects: Collaborate seamlessly with team members on automation workflows.
- Advanced control: Utilize Git-based version control for better management of changes.
🏷️ Pricing Information n8n is available at €24 per month. While there is no free plan, a free trial allows users to explore its capabilities before committing. This pricing structure is designed to cater to teams looking for robust features without upfront costs.
Pros and Cons
✅ Pros:
- Offers open-source freedom, allowing for extensive customization.
- Robust enterprise-grade features suitable for complex automation.
- Strong community support for troubleshooting and development.
❌ Cons:
- The learning curve can be steep for beginners unfamiliar with automation tools.
- Requires technical expertise to maximize its potential.
- Limited documentation may pose challenges during the initial setup.
In summary, n8n stands out as a powerful tool for teams seeking to enhance their software development and testing capabilities through effective workflow automation.
Best for Developers and Tech Experimenters: Pipedream

Best for: Pipedream is the ideal platform for developers and tech experimenters who seek a harmonious blend of low-code and traditional coding options. It empowers users to rapidly prototype and automate workflows, making it a go-to choice for those in software development and testing capabilities.
Key Features
- Multi-language support: Enables developers to work in various programming languages, enhancing flexibility.
- Extensive app integrations: Connects seamlessly with numerous applications, streamlining workflow automation.
- Credit-based execution: Offers a unique credit system for running workflows, allowing for efficient resource management.
- Real-time debugging: Facilitates immediate troubleshooting, improving the development process.
- Open-source tool: Encourages collaboration and innovation within the developer community.
🏷️ Pricing Information Pipedream offers a free plan at $0/month, which includes 300 credits per month and a daily limit of 10 credits. Paid plans are available for users who require additional resources, making it accessible for both casual and heavy users.
✅ Pros:
- Generous free tier encourages experimentation and learning.
- Developer-friendly interface supports both low-code and traditional coding.
- Versatile coding support caters to a wide range of automation needs.
❌ Cons:
- Credit limits may hinder performance for users with heavy usage.
- Some advanced features may require a learning curve.
- Limited support options for free-tier users may affect troubleshooting.
In summary, Pipedream stands out as a powerful tool for those looking to enhance productivity through automation, making it a valuable asset in the tech landscape.
